- AnecdotesThe movie was filmed in Rhinebeck, NY, not Vermont. In the scene where Nash and Megan take the carriage ride through town, the "Rhinebeck Hardware Company" store can be seen in the background.
- GaffesThe movie takes place in Vermont just before Christmas, but it was shot in the State of New York. However, the only time you see December and winter in the movie is in the stock footage as it was shot in the spring. Production used a lot of artificial snow to hide it in the close shots, but wide shots always reveal a lot of beautiful green deciduous trees, and bushes everywhere. Also you can see snow on green tree leaves, too. Furthermore, loud bird singing is heard through the day in the outdoor scenes and birds don't sing in the autumn and winter.
